Spring/summer/fall of 2013 - ConstructionI - We will commence construction on a new home on Jennifer Lane in Manchester in early May. In addition, we will be undertaking some minor repairs in or near to Bennington.
Directions to Jennifer Lane - From the north or south - take Route 7 to the Manchester exit - go east onto Route 11/30. Go 1/2 mile - take a right after Atlantic Painting on Jennifer Lane. Go straight to the back of the circle - park along side the road but do not block a driveway.
Individuals can self-schedule - come whenever and as often as they want.
Groups of four or more people need to be scheduled in advance. Please contact us by email or by phone (802) 367-1000. The Group Schedule is listed on the box on the left side of this page.
Information for Volunteers Volunteers should plan to arrive no earlier than 8:30 a.m. We usually work to 3:00 p.m. on Wednesdays and Saturdays. People are welcome to work as long or as little as their time allows.
It is good to bring work gloves. A mid-morning snack will be provided. If you plan to work after lunch, it is best to bring yourself something to eat. All volunteers must sign a release form before they work the first day. You can download the form for ADULTS and volunteers ages 16 and 17 (MINORS). Skilled Help with Construction
We always need help from volunteers who are experienced with any aspect of construction. In particular, it is very helpful when those people with special skills are willing to assist others who have little or no experience.
